I changed the oil on my 2006 Town and Country,and when I took for a test
drive, ALL the oil leaked out!  Plug is on good, filter seems tight and the cap is
on.  HELP!  any ideas on where to start?

Have it towed back to the oil change shop and have them check it out (at their expense). I think they probably left the filter loose.

Check to see if the old gasket came off with the filter. Also double check the part number as you may have the wrong filter.

Some oil change places seem to think they need to use a filter wrench to INSTALL the new filter and may have made a small hole in the filter also may have double gaskets installed won't take long either way to ruin an engine.
